  1. get my hard drive back to normal!!!! or so my computer can read it again!


    So i plugged my 1000g hard drive into the xbox one thinking i could play my movies off of it like the old xbox. But it formatted it once plugged it in and now when i return it to my computer it does not recognize it and having to format it back to normal
    will delete all my files on the drive.....

    I don't want to lose my 500gigs of movies i have on there because the only way i can think to get my computer to recognize it is to format it back and cant do that without all my files getting deleted

    get my hard drive back to normal!!!! or so my computer can read it again!

    I reckon the movies have already been lost because you formatted it when plugging it into your Xbox One.

    With the June update external storage only supports game files, not movie/song playback (although that's been debated for future release).

    However, formatting it for the Xbox One is a similar process to formatting it for your PC, so the hard drive should already have been wiped of all content.

    External Storage Hard drive

    Could be a dead drive. You coukd try plugging it into a PC to see if it is recognized at all. If it is recognized by the PC you could then try again to mount it to the xbox. If not then you coukd try a new cord.
    This so far is the best option presented. At this point, you can plug it into a computer and it won’t read any of the files but it will acknowledge that the hard drive is plugged in. That is definitely going to be a good sign if that happens, that just means
    your Xbox for some reason isn’t reading it but the hard drive isnt fried...at least not yet. If your hard drive works on a PC, and if you don’t have a really large hard drive with tons of games on it, the easiest option might be to just format the hard drive
    on a computer to NTFS file format, then bring it to the Xbox and reformat it on there to get it to work and hopefully everything goes as it’s supposed to

    It will suck having to download the games again, but you will have your hard drive back hopefully
